Within the National Fellowship of Raceway Ministries, there are represented different denominational and non-denominational backgrounds.  This statement of faith is an expression of basic Biblical principles which undergird our common commitment to share the Gospel of Christ with the motor sports community. 
God, Jesus, Holy Spirit
We believe there is one God, eternally existing in three persons: the Father, the Son, and the Holy Spirit.
God the FATHER is the origin and content of the revelation.  It is God the Father who wills to make Himself known, and the Father is the name by which He wills that we should call upon Him (Matthew 6:6-13). 

God the SON, Jesus Christ, is the historic mediator of the revelation.  It is the Son who has made God known as Father (Matthew 11:27; John 1:18, 16:25, 17:1ff; Hebrews 1:3), and whom we know as Savior and Lord. 

God the HOLY SPIRIT is the present reality of the revelation.  The Holy Spirit, abiding in the believer (John 14:16-17), bears constant witness to God as Father (Romans 8:15; Galatians 4:6), and to Jesus as God's Son and our Savior (Romans 8:9-17). 
Bible
We believe that the Bible is God's written revelation to man; that it is inspired in all its parts; and that it is the singular certain, sufficient, and authoritative basis for what humanity is to believe and live. 
Deity of Jesus Christ
We believe in the deity of Jesus Christ--His virgin birth, sinless life, and miracles; His death on the cross to provide for our redemption; His bodily resurrection, and ascension into heaven; His present ministry of intercession for us; and His return to earth in power and glory. 
Personality and Deity of the Holy Spirit
We believe in the personality and deity of the Holy Spirit--that He performs the miracle of the new birth in unbelievers; and that He indwells believers, enabling them to live godly lives.
Humanity, Sin, Salvation
We believe that humanity was created in the image of God, but because of sin was alienated from God; that God was at work in the life, death and resurrection of Jesus to reconcile sinful humanity to Himself; and that by trusting Christ alone for salvation can that alienation be removed. 
The Church
We believe the church, of which Christ is the Head, consists of all those who believe on the Lord Jesus Christ and are redeemed through His blood; and that the church has been commissioned by Christ to go into all the world proclaiming the Gospel to all peoples everywhere.
